Traditional Taste of Konya: Cheese Pide

Discover the taste of cheese pide in Meram, Konya. Baked in stone ovens, this unique pide leaves an unforgettable flavor on your palate as the cheese melts and blends with the dough.
Cheese pide, a part of Konya's rich culinary culture, is a must-try delicacy in the Meram district. The abundant cheese sprinkled on thin and crispy dough meets the heat of the stone oven, creating a delightful aroma. Typically garnished with fresh tomatoes, peppers, and olives, this pide can also be crowned with a fried egg.
Cheese pide is particularly favored for breakfast. It adds joy to morning tables when served with brewed tea. Made with local cheeses of Konya, this pide can be diversified with different types of cheese. Cheddar, feta, or tulum cheese further enhance the flavor of the pide.
Many traditional restaurants in Meram offer this delicacy to their customers. Attracting both locals and tourists, the cheese pide is a taste that should not be missed during your visit to Konya. The crispiness from the stone oven and the delicious harmony of cheese make this dish even more special.
